Blind Level Time and Increase Schedules

Blind level duration constitutes among the most crucial variables impacting tournament dynamics, as accelerated formats in low deposit casinos compress time for decisions and amplify variance substantially. Turbo and hyper-turbo formats with blinds increasing every 3-5 minutes demand aggressive play and frequent all-in situations, while conventional formats with 10-15 minute levels permit more nuanced strategic adjustments.

The progression structure itself determines how rapidly players move from deep-stack play to push-fold situations, with grasping these dynamics being crucial for achievement in low deposit casinos across different speed formats. Standard formats typically increase blinds every level or two, whereas certain structures feature slower blind growth that favor patient positional play over aggressive play and push-fold mathematics.

Initial Stack Depths and Their Strategic Impact

Initial stack size compared against initial blinds creates the foundational strategy for tournament play in early stages, with deeper stacks in low deposit casinos enabling post-flop complexity and speculative hand selections. Tournaments offering 200+ big blind opening stacks favor experienced players who excel at post-flop decisions, while shallower 50-100 big blind structures diminish the skill advantage and increase the importance of preflop selection.

The opening stack depth significantly correlates with how long players can utilize cash game-style strategies before shifting toward tournament-specific approaches within low deposit casinos environments. Deeper structures allow for set-mining, suited connector play, and multi-street bluffing sequences, whereas smaller stacks demand tighter ranges, higher aggression frequencies, and earlier adoption of independent chip model considerations throughout the tournament structure.

Prize Distribution Frameworks and Prize Pool Allocation

Prize pool structures significantly influence winning approaches, as top-heavy structures in low deposit casinos favor aggressive strategies focused on tournament victories instead of min-cashes. Structures compensating 10-12% of the field with large first-place payouts demand risk-taking and chip accumulation, while flatter payout structures paying out to 15-20% of the field encourage more conservative approaches centered on preservation and steady progress.

Understanding how prize distributions influence Independent Chip Model calculations enables players make sound mathematical decisions in bubble situations and final stage scenarios within low deposit casinos competitions. The relationship between stack sizes, remaining players and payout jumps creates complicated strategic considerations where the correct play often contradicts stack-building strategies, compelling players to manage survival value against chip accumulation based on particular payout distributions.
